You will be asked if you want to replace ‘slim’ with lightdm, answer ‘yes’ when the script ‘pops up. ![]() Grsync tutorial install#(To start, cut & paste the following into a terminal window) Code: sudo apt-get update -y sudo apt-get install xserver-xorg x11-xserver-utils xfonts-base x11-utils lightdm lightdm-gtk-greeter xfce4 xfce4-power-manager xfce4-power-manager-plugins xfce4-taskmanager blueman bluez-tools pulseaudio pulseaudio-module-bluetooth pavucontrol -y -allow-unauthenticated gvfs gvfs-backends light-locker lightdm-gtk-greeter-settings lxpolkit desktop-profiles greybird-gtk-theme catfish xfce4-whiskermenu-plugin kupfer xfce4-terminal thunar-volman thunar-archive-plugin tumbler tumbler-common tumbler-plugins-extra pulseaudio pavucontrol pasystray paman You will need to add other xfce4-goodies later, if you want them. To initiate the xfce4 build, begin by adding the following applications to create an xfce4 install with whiskermenu. I prefer using the space-icewm environment. Once you have the basic antiX version installed, log in to one of the traditional window manager setups. To begin, install a recent antiX per normal procedure (I used and tested this tutorial on antiX19alpha2 version this may work with previous 17.4 versions, as well).
